The NIST Standard Reference Materials for organic contaminants in human body fluids reflect changes in contaminant levels since the last materials were issued in 2000 levels of PCBs, pesticides, dioxins/furans and other contaminants have decreased by 50 percent while the levels of brominated flame retardants have been on the rise.
